Hey guys -

We're back in full force now after our wind-down, and we've been working on a "FAQ" blog to put out. Posting on forums and answering questions directly on Twitter just hasn't been widespread enough (since we keep getting the same questions asked), so this seemed like the best logical idea.

I've definitely been trying to read everything from the community, but I figured I'd open it up to make sure we gather all the most important questions in one place. We'll close this up by the weekend and try to have the blog out next week.

ONE REQUEST: NO DISCUSSION - JUST QUESTIONS.

To get the big one out of the way:

"When is the first title update coming out, and what is in it?"

The first patch is done on our end and in the hands of 3rd party for approvals, so I *think* we'll be able to release all the details about what's in the 1st title update in the official FAQ blog.

Here is my list of questions:

-Will some of the animations that look weird and play out in the wrong situations be fixed? (e.g. the over the shoulder catch happening WAY too frequently).

-Will DBs cutting on routes at the EXACT same time as the receivers (sometimes they even cut before the receivers do) be fixed?

-Will DBs in perfect position to make plays yet just stand there and do nothing even when you mash on the swat button be fixed? For those that call this a minor annoyance, I will ask: Would it be OK if the same thing happened to your QB when trying to throw the ball?

-Will CPU LBs and DTs that drop back in coverage and stand there and watch balls literally sail right over their heads to receivers standing directly behind them be fixed?

-What happened to custom stadium sounds like the Lions siren that plays when they score a touchdown, or the lion roar that happens on first downs? It was in the game last year (and the year before that) if I remember correctly.

-I have had three games now where the first play of the game the CPU RB breaks out of a 4-6 man Pro-Tack "scrum" and runs for a 65+ yard touchdown. Can this be toned down?

-Will receivers having no sense of the sidelines at all be fixed?

-Will suction blocking be fixed?

-Speed often times seems to be more important than route running for WRs, will this be fixed/adjusted?

-WRs don't go and get or battle for the ball enough. They are just content to do the good ole' "right in the bread basket" catch, which is totally useless in most situations. Will this be fixed?

-Still can't get pressure on the QB, and even if you do get to the QB, the CPU refuses to take sacks and always "magically" finds an open receiver just before getting hit. Will this be fixed?

-Will the terrible pursuit angles taken by the CPU defenders be fixed?

-Will the excessive trucking by backs and wide receivers who shouldn't be trucking be fixed?

-Will physics on batted passes be fixed? The ball should be going straight to the ground in most instances, not bouncing off guys leg or bodies and then magically floating in the air for the safety or LB to intercept.

-Zone coverage is broken altogether, and safties in zone don't always break their coverage assignment and come to make a tackle when the offense calls a run play. Will this be fixed?

-Will pass rushers with a clear shot at the QB inexplicably changing directions and delaying sacking the QB be fixed?

-As mentioned numerous times, passing to the flats is way too easy, as is beating the CPU when they blitz. Almost every time the CPU blitzes there is a man wide open that can gain HUGE amounts of yards if not a touchdown. Will this be fixed?

-Will seeing more variety in penalty calls be fixed? (e.g. Defensive Holding, Pass interference, etc...)

-CPU quick snap is still alive and well and is flat out terrible on Field Goal attempts, will this be fixed?

-DB and WR jostling is barely present, will this be fixed?

-Adaptive AI isn't working properly, will this be fixed?

-Wide receivers in the run and return game (especially on breakaway runs) turn and block the wrong guy, allowing defenders to make plays on you that they shouldn't have been able to. Will this be fixed?

-Will Lower rated DTs coming off their blocks too easily and making plays on runs up the middle be fixed?

-On kick returns there are still blockers that sometimes run all the way downfield past the defenders and towards the end zone (all the while blocking not one soul), will this be fixed?

-Toss and sweep plays still get blown up way too much for lost yardage. Ditto for screen plays (there always seems to be a DT that is standing right next to my RB, even if that's the first time I called that play). Will this be fixed?

-CPU still punts the ball through the end zone instead of trying to pin me deep, will this be fixed?

-WRs on some plays (curl routes especially) just stand there frozen solid after running their route, most times even after the play breaks down. Will this be fixed?

-Weight, momentum and physics seem to mean absolutely NOTHING. There are certain animations where a guy is on his way to the ground, only to magically pop back up and truck someone for extra yards. Will this be fixed?

-There are still way too many missed blocks/people blocking the wrong guy in the run game. Will the run blocking AI/Logic be fixed?

-Will DBs and WRs warping forward a few yards to catch/intercept passes be fixed?

-Fields don't degrade enough, or at least some (like Heinz Field) should degrade a lot more than others. Will this be fixed? (It was patched before in the past).

Ian,
I have two questions for you. Thanks.
1. Will the awareness of CPU offensive players of the sideline be improved? Right now, offensive players seem to be more than willing to go out of bounds in situations where they should be trying to get extra yards. Outside blockers also routinely seem to go out of bounds on kickoffs.
2. Will there be any adjustment made to the logic of the team ahead in regards to the end of game and two minute drill? Specific examples of errors are below:
--teams ahead by 7+ points with <5 minutes to play in the 4th quarter not running the play clock down.
--:30 left in game. Team ahead has has the ball and a first down. Defense has one time out. Team runs a running play instead of QB kneel.
--teams head in last five minutes are not running down the clock until they get below 2 minutes.
--teams ahead in the first half seem very passive about trying to agressively most the ball into scoring territory.
--the hurry-up speed to the line of scrimmage seems to be above real by 2-3 seconds per play. It should be slowed down a bit to be more realistic.

I have a log of specific incidents in terms of two-minute logic that is available for your review if you are interested.
